Ian Lance Taylor Put all the files in one package in a single directory undef GOPATH/src. Only put a single package in each directory (except that you can use a _test package in _test.go files). Ian -- You received this message because you are subscribed to the Google Groups "golang-nuts" group.
May 31, 2016 · In addition to Bhuiyan Mohammad Iklash ‘s answer, since you access internet not frequently, there is case when a package is not updated . Better to run go get -u all or go get -u [name of package] In this lesson on Scanner package in Golang, we will study various examples on how to use Scanners in multiple ways in Go programming language. We will get started now. Starting with Go. Just to make sure we have the environment setup consistently, here is the directory structure which I made for my Hello World program: Here is the program we ... Feb 19, 2018 · golang go how to install package from Github a) Create workspace directory structure $mkdir myproject $cd myproject $mkdir bin $mkdir src $mkdir pkg b) Expor... At GitHub, we’re building the text editor we’ve always wanted: hackable to the core, but approachable on the first day without ever touching a config file. We can’t wait to see what you build with it. Step 2: Search and install “Golang Tools Integration” from package control. Step 3(optional): Configure the Settings for golang and your project following the golang.sublime-settings and ExampleProject.sublime-project. Typically, the full features of 'guru' need use the configuration of the project. Tips In many other languages, the directory is used for "namespacing" bunch of files, like handlers or models, but in Go, the directory is a separate package (i.e. library). So "structuring folders" in Go actually means "how do you abstract code into subpackages and when".
  • Could you post a listing of the directory C:\Users\502380\go\pkg\mod\golang.org\x\? Are you able to reproduce this or did it just happen once? How about after clearing the module cache with go clean -modcache?
  • Deploying Firefox on MacOS using PKG and Jamf This article is for IT Admins who want to configure Firefox on their organization's computers. Download the macOS .pkg for the release version and language you want to deploy:
The pkg dir has a sub-directory with the platform (Win 64) that contains the packages organized by their origin (github.com, golang.com, etc.). The src directory has similar sub-directories for the origin repository or website (github.com, golang.org, etc.).
»

Golang pkg directory

The directory name for each application should match the name of the executable you want to have (e.g., /cmd/myapp). Don't put a lot of code in the application directory. If you think the code can be imported and used in other projects, then it should live in the /pkg directory.

Terminals also allow you to manipulate files and folders on your computer. You terminal starts in a working directory where you can list the folder contents with ls, change directories using cd, make directories using mkdir and remove files using rm. Homebrew. Homebrew is a package manager for OSX. All the source files for go should be located in a directory named src inside the workspace. So lets create directory src inside the go directory we created above. Every go project should in turn have its own subdirectory inside src. Lets create a directory hello inside src to hold the hello world project. Jul 17, 2019 · Yes, exactly. Editors like Vim might not write anything to disk for a while, but the user will still be editing their file. We need some way to guess an import path given a directory. The code in go/packages that does this is here, and it only works because, previously, go list returned the "guess" of what that directory's import path was.

The go-plus package offers almost all Golang support in Atom. It can also be used for tools, build flows, linters, vet and coverage tools. Go-plus also includes various code snippets and features such as autocomplete with gocode, code formatting with gofmt, goreturns, or goimports, and more. Bible verses about mistreating your wife kjvThe version package permits running a specific version of Go. Solutions Use Cases Case Studies Learn Playground Tour Stack Overflow

Jul 04, 2018 · All other download and installation related information are available at golang.org. Go Installation Directory. ... If a package has a compiled object file in the pkg directory for current system ...

The directory name is generated by taking pattern and applying a random string to the end. If pattern includes a "*", the random string replaces the last "*". TempDir returns the name of the new directory. If dir is the empty string, TempDir uses the default directory for temporary files (see os.TempDir). Feb 21, 2020 · Package ecdsa provides an internal version of ecdsa.Verify that is used for the Wycheproof tests. md4: Package md4 implements the MD4 hash algorithm as defined in RFC 1320. nacl/auth: Package auth authenticates a message using a secret key. nacl/box: Package box authenticates and encrypts small messages using public-key cryptography. nacl/secretbox

The go-plus package offers almost all Golang support in Atom. It can also be used for tools, build flows, linters, vet and coverage tools. Go-plus also includes various code snippets and features such as autocomplete with gocode, code formatting with gofmt, goreturns, or goimports, and more. Jun 03, 2019 · func main is just a function name but when used with package main, it serves as the application entry point. fmt is a golang package that implements formatted I/O. Set up the HTTP server using ... Terminals also allow you to manipulate files and folders on your computer. You terminal starts in a working directory where you can list the folder contents with ls, change directories using cd, make directories using mkdir and remove files using rm. Homebrew. Homebrew is a package manager for OSX. Mar 28, 2017 · Create a directory if it does not exist. Otherwise do nothing. os.MkdirAll is similar to mkdir -p in shell command, which also creates parent directory if not exists.. Tested on: Go 1.8, Ubuntu Linux 16.10

Mar 27, 2017 · [Golang] Check if File, Directory, or Symlink Exist ... Check if a file, directory, or symbolic link exists in Golang ... Package write provides a way to atomically ... Aug 05, 2015 · |-package_demo.go The answer is when I ran the "install" command, Go saw the extra package import and found that it, too, needed compilation. I can run the install command just on the package and it'll compile and insert it into my /go/pkg directory, but I didn't need to.

In this lesson on Scanner package in Golang, we will study various examples on how to use Scanners in multiple ways in Go programming language. We will get started now. Starting with Go. Just to make sure we have the environment setup consistently, here is the directory structure which I made for my Hello World program: Here is the program we ... Mar 19, 2019 · The go command resolves imports by using the specific dependency module versions listed in go.mod.When it encounters an import of a package not provided by any module in go.mod, the go command automatically looks up the module containing that package and adds it to go.mod, using the latest version. As agopherWe need to know his package management, so that we can rationalize the code structure and do a good job in project management. (gopherHamster) 2. Before GOPATH/Golang 1.5. GolangPack management has always been a demographic disease, and it started withGOPATHTo manage dependency libraries is particularly simple and crude.

Now my package directory has been created and it's code has been written. I recommend that you use the same name for your packages as their corresponding directories, and that the directories contain all of the package source files. Compile packages. We've already created our package above, but how do we compile it for practical purposes? 13 issues skipped by the security teams: CVE-2018-6574: Go before 1.8.7, Go 1.9.x before 1.9.4, and Go 1.10 pre-releases before Go 1.10rc2 allow "go get" remote command execution during source code build, by leveraging the gcc or clang plugin feature, because -fplugin= and -plugin= arguments were not blocked.

Dec 09, 2019 · Your actual application code can go in the /internal/app directory (e.g., /internal/app/myapp) and the code shared by those apps in the /internal/pkg directory (e.g., /internal/pkg/myprivlib). .

Body language hand on shoulder in picture

13 issues skipped by the security teams: CVE-2018-6574: Go before 1.8.7, Go 1.9.x before 1.9.4, and Go 1.10 pre-releases before Go 1.10rc2 allow "go get" remote command execution during source code build, by leveraging the gcc or clang plugin feature, because -fplugin= and -plugin= arguments were not blocked. Readdir reads the contents of the directory associated with file and returns a slice of up to n FileInfo values, as would be returned by Lstat, in directory order. Subsequent calls on the same file will yield further FileInfos.

 

Add another email account to office 365

Dometic coolmatic crx 100